Pros

* Leadership invests in your career - your success is their success *Transparency all the way down from the CEO. You will always know what is going on in the company along with what goals the company wants to achieve. In regards to transparency, leadership encourages you to share your ideas - you aren't just a number. *Not micro-managed: leadership trusts you to do your job but is there to offer you guidance and make sure you're reaching your goals *Work/Life balance: you're encouraged to use your vacation days. Leadership believes you perform best when you take time off when you need it to recharge *Equipped with the right tools: Leadership is always looking at new technology to help make your life easier in the role. They want to make sure you have the right tools so you can do your job more efficiently. *The product: Asite's product is really good; clients see the value in it

Cons

*Brand awareness: Asite is new in the North American market so brand awareness isn't here yet, BUT there is heavy investment and campaigns being run to improve recognition. LinkedIN followers continue to climb due to marketing that is taking place

Pros

- Global organization - Consistent year over year growth, even during COVID! - Very transparent with organizational results, goals, and strategy - Stable environment for a software company. Company has been around for 20 years. Good to know we aren't going anywhere! - High goals as a BDR, but still given autonomy to achieve these goals. No micromanaging. - Management actively engaged with strategic partnerships. - Everyone, including leadership, wants to help you succeed. - Bought-in culture of hard work, accountability, integrity, and having a work-life balance. - Constant communication and support with global CEO, Nathan Doughty. - Half of the company is employed in Product, assuring it is always cutting-edge. - Great office location. - Ability to wear multiple hats. - Collaborative environment with bright sales professionals.

Cons

- The North American arm of Asite is small at the moment, which may not fare well for someone used to bigger teams. - While Asite is a market leader globally, it is still relatively new to the North America market, which sometimes leads to challenges with brand awareness. - Given the North American team is newer, many processes aren't fine-tuned, which may not be good for some people, but is good for people who can "figure it out" to say.
